Rose Absolute

Concentrated aromatic compound obtained from Rosa damascena via solvent extraction, a type of absolute covered in this heading. Falls under HTS 3301.29.51 as non-citrus essential oil derivatives including absolutes. Primarily used in high-end perfumery for its intense floral scent.

Import Tips & Compliance

β€’ Provide extraction method documentation (solvent vs steam) to distinguish from resinoids or concretes

β€’ Test for residual solvents to meet FDA import standards for cosmetic ingredients

β€’ Declare as 'absolute' on entry to prevent confusion with diluted perfumes under 3307
